Scotland vs Ireland, 1st ODI at Aberdeen, Aug 22 2009 - Ball by Ball Commentary
Well that's it. Ireland have dominated this game from the early overs of Scotland innings and their precise spin bowling took them out of the game. It's been a poor performance from Scotland who never really got going.
The Irish are singing away in the away changing room while the Scottish door is locked and they're getting a stern talking to from the coaches. The weather has been lovely here in Aberdeen for a change but do join us tomorrow for the second ODI where
Scotland will try and put up a better fight to a decent Irish team.
The game tomorrow is due to start at 10.45 and the weather forecast is mixed with a few heavy showers due at some point. It could be a stop-start affair with Duckworth-Lewis involved. We will see you tomorrow but for now thanks for joining us here at
cricinfo with me Callum Stewart.
